Stress Can Cause Loss of Facial Hair

Various studies suggest that stress causes the production of cortisol in the body. When high levels of cortisol are present, the adrenal glands begin to produce fewer hormones that promote hair growth. This comes as the result of crashing levels of the testosterone/ DHT hormone. Testosterone levels directly affect beard growth. There is some evidence that how fast your beard grows is determined by the amount of dihydrotestosterone (DHT) you produce, a byproduct of testosterone. Thus, too much stress can actually slow the growth of your beard.

Stress can also constrict blood vessels, this restricts the flow of vitamins and nutrients to hair follicles limit the ability of a man to grow a healthy beard.

Dealing With Stress To Save Your Beard

Working out helps increase testosterone levels in the body

• Get More Sleep – It helps the body to function at optimal levels and enhances regeneration of testosterone.

•  Yoga helps reduce stress, lower blood pressure, and lower your heart rate.

• Reduce Stressors: Effective time-management skills, asking for help when appropriate, setting priorities, pacing yourself, and taking time out to focus on yourself.
